Oxford, AL – On Saturday, April 15th there will be a Journey for Hope Walk from 9:00 am to 11:00 am at 945 Leon Smith Pkwy in Oxford. This event is open to the community. There will be fun for kids and a playground will be available for the children not participating in the walk. Registration begins at 9:30 am. You can contact the administrative office at (256)236-7381 with any questions. 2nd Chance provides safe shelter and supportive services empowering victims of domestic and sexual violence and provides educational outreach to the communities served to create awareness of and strengthen the movement to end this violence.
